PoliticsPhotos Of The NLNG Plant In Bonny Island, Rivers State That FG Wants To Sell by chie8(op): 7:09am On Sep 26, 2016
According to Henry Omoregie he was part of the NLNG construction history from the scratch including piping,electrical and safety supervision.He said NLNG was built (first 2 trains) for 3.8 billion USD. With an additional train, it shot up to 4.2 billion USD with plans to expand to about 7 trains on hold, it should (construction-ly speaking) worth about 10 - 15 billion USD or so. That is less than the billions of dollars figures the APC-led Nigeria has been bandying about, as recovered loot.

The JV agreement is shared 49% for Nigeria (NNPC) and the rest 51% by Shell, (biggest share of the other 3 at about 25%) Agip (ENI Group) and Total (then TotalFinaElf).

He said he understands during his sojourn in Bonny Island, that the plant would be wholly NNPC's after 22 years (counting from 1999 or just before). That means in 2021, 51% becomes an addition to the 49% = 100% Naija-owned.He also said the most expensive single ''asset'' in Nigeria and Africa today is the NLNG Plant in Bonny Island, Rivers State Nigeria.

Politics22 Boko Haram Members Killed Today By Troops In Logomani by chie8(op): 9:22pm On Sep 25, 2016
TROOPS REPEL ATTACK AT LOGOMANI

At about 1.00am today, Sunday 25th September 2016, some suspected remnants of Boko Haram fighters attacked our troops location of at Logomani along Dikwa-Gambarou road, Borno State, in a 3 wave attack using 36 Hand Grenades and Rocket Propelled Launchers.

Our troops fought gallantly and repelled the attack which lasted for about one hour. At the end of the fierce encounter, the troops counted 22 dead bodies of Boko Haram fighters.

They also recovered 2 AK-47 Rifles, 1 FN Rifle, 1 G3 Rifle and some 36 Hand grenades.

Unfortunately, we lost 4 soldiers and their rifles as a result of the effect of Boko Haram use of Rocket Propelled Grenades, while 2 soldiers were wounded in action.

The wounded in action have been evacuated for further medical management.

The location have been reinforced and replenished while the troops have continued their clearance operations.

PoliticsGovernor Tambuwal Flags-off Construction Of N1.2billion School In Balle(pics) by chie8(op): 10:45am On Sep 25, 2016
Governor Aminu Tambuwal yesterday laid the foundation for the construction of the N 1.2 billion Government Secondary School, Balle, headquarters of Gudu Local Government of the state.

The governor explained that, the state government embarked on the project as the area had remained the only one out of the 23 local governments of the state without a Senior Secondary School.He added that, the school will be a co-educational one, both for boys and girls.

Governor Tambuwal also stated that, the new school will attract students from the state, other states of Nigeria and others from the neighbouring Niger republic and also bolster integration between the state and the neighbouring Niger republic.Governor Tambuwal maintained that establishment of the school and sending of students are part of the agenda of his recent meeting with President Muhammadou Isoufou of Niger republic.

The governor also promised to make funds available for the completion of the project on schedule, and according to specifications.He further explained that, the establishment of the school is aimed at improving enrolment, retention and completion of students across the state as well as improving equal access to education for both the boy and girl children in the state.

Tambuwal called on the contracting firm to complete the work on schedule,warning that, compromise by supervising engineers would not be condoned.

The Governor also inaugurated the disbursement of N 211 million grants of the Nigeria Partnership For Education Project and the World Bank where he commended the NIPEP/World Bank for providing the fund in order to assist the people and Government of sokoto state with the sole aim of uplifting the standard of education in the state.He called on other well-meaning individuals to emulate the gesture by providing scholarship to students and also urged school Based Management Committee (SBMC) to utilize the grants as per the work plan and the laid down regulations as the government will deal decisively with any erring School Based Management Committee.

The Sultan of Sokoto, Alhaji Sa'ad Abubakar III,commended the state government for embarking on the project and stressed the need for all children to have equal opportunities to education.He decried street begging by some children, averring that,such obnoxious act was unIslamic.The sultan urged wealthy individuals to provide scholarship to the children of less privileged.The Commissioner of Basic and Secondary Education,Dr Jabbi Kilgori,said that, the project consists of 12 classrooms, laboratories, library, hostels, staff quarters and clinics, among others.

PoliticsBuhari Signs Paris Agreement;Says 9ja Will Reverse Effects Of Climate Change(Pix by chie8(op): 9:56pm On Sep 22, 2016
President Muhammadu Buhari has said that his signing of the Paris Agreement on Climate Change has demonstrated Nigeria’s commitment to a global effort to reverse the effects of the negative trend.
The President said this while addressing the opening of the meeting on Taking Climate Action for Sustainable Development in New York, co-hosted by Nigeria and the United Nations Environment Programme (UNEP) as one of the Side Events of the 71st Session of the United Nations General Assembly (UNGA71).
President Buhari, had shortly before this event, signed the Paris Agreement, where he committed Nigeria to reducing “Green House Gas Emissions unconditionally by 20 per cent and conditionally by 45 per cent” in line with Nigeria’s Nationally Determined Contributions.” Describing the signing as historic, he had also expressed confidence that with support from development partners, Nigeria will meet the above targets.
The President also promised to ensure the ratification of the Paris Agreement before the 22nd Conference of Parties to the UN Framework Convention on Climate Change in Marrakesh, Morocco in November 2016.
He stressed that it was to demonstrate his personal dedication to the process of implementing the Agreement that he was hosting the side event on Taking Climate Action Towards Sustainable Development.
President Buhari, who said he was privileged to have been part of the Paris Agreement, expressed appreciation to what he called “the genuine efforts by President Francois Hollande of France in drawing global attention to reviving the Lake Chad Basin,” and for galvanizing the political will that led to the global consensus in reaching the Paris Agreement.
The Nigerian President said his country’s commitment to the Paris Agreement is articulated through its Nationally Determined Contributions (NDCs) “that strive to build a climate resilient society across the diverse terrain of Nigeria. We have instituted an Inter-Ministerial Committee on Climate Change to govern implementation of my country’s NDCs, thereby ensuring a strong cross-sectoral approach, coherence and synergy for Climate Action.”
President Buhari, while admitting that implementing the Roadmap will not be easy in the face of dwindling national revenues, however, indicated that both internal and external resources would be mobilized to meet Nigeria’s targets, adding that the 2017 Budget will reflect Nigeria’s efforts to accord priority to realizing its NDCs.
“In addition, we are set to launch our first ever Green Bonds in the first quarter of 2017 to fund a pipeline of projects all targeted at reducing emissions towards a greener economy,” he said.
While urging global support to transit to a low-carbon climate resilient economy, the President specifically reminded industrialized nations “to play their role and deliver on their commitments on access to climate finance and technology transfer and help with capacity-building,” adding that, “Expectations are high for their leaders to deliver US$100 billion per year by 2020 in support of developing countries to take climate action, thus keeping the promise to billions of people.”
President Buhari, who thanked the Presidents of Chad, Cameroon, Democratic Republic of Congo and Niger for attending the event, also called on the international community to “give special recognition to the plight of Lake Chad and support our effort to resuscitate the livelihoods of over 5 million people in the region. This will reinforce our efforts to reintegrate the thousands of Boko Haram victims and returning Internally Displaced Persons (IDPs).”
The President noted that the Niger Delta region is a unique biodiversity rich in coastal environment that is highly prone to adverse environmental changes occasioned by climate change, such as sea level rise, coastal erosion, exacerbated by poverty and many decades of oil pollution leading to loss of livelihoods and ecosystems.
He added however, that “through an integrated approach, implementation of the NDCs, and our efforts to clean up Ogoniland, we will improve livelihoods, protect the environment and take climate action, and ensure the implementation of the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s).”

BusinessTony Elumelu Wins Africa Investor ‘Person Of The Year’ Award In New York(photos) by chie8(op): 7:03am On Sep 21, 2016
September 20

Yesterday, I was honoured to receive the ‘Person of the Year’ award at the Africa Investor CEO Institutional Investment Summit hosted alongside the UN General Assembly in New York.

I dedicated my award to all Transcorp Power staff who remain committed to realizing our dream of improving access to electricity in Nigeria and making our vision of a well-lit, fully powered Nigeria come true. Because of their hard work and diligence, Transcorp Power is now the biggest producer of thermal energy in Nigeria, providing about 18% of national output: As many of you know, Transcorp Power has also supported U.S. President Obama’s Power Africa initiative with a $2.5billion commitment.

I also dedicated my award to all stakeholders working hard to improve access to power in Africa. I strongly urge local and global institutional investors to consider long-term opportunities on the continent to join us in this journey to powering Africa out of poverty. This call to the investment community is critical as the economies of African regional powerhouses like Democratic Republic of Congo, Mozambique, Uganda, Nigeria and Angola struggle due to excessive exposure to commodities’ prices caused by limited diversification. We need a sustainable solution to reduce our historical external vulnerability. Africa has been faced with this same challenge, in my view, for far too long.

I choose to look at the recent episodes of economic contraction across the continent as opportunities to diversify our economies and invest in building critical infrastructure, especially in power, to reduce our susceptibility to commodity shocks and break out of the perpetual boom-bust cycles.

To ensure a different type of growth trajectory for Africa – one that does not rely exclusively on the export of primary commodities –  there must be reliable, accessible, affordable electricity, to support industrialization on a massive scale to power us out of chronic dependency on commodities. We must power Africa’s next phase of development, by targeting and prioritizing growth of our manufacturing, industries and services.

While there is an abundance of private capital available, at the local and global levels, to be deployed to develop the African power sector, government must play its part in attracting these investments. As we know, private capital goes to where it is most welcome. Our African governments should ensure that they create a conducive environment that will attract and retain these investments in our continent. Foreign investors can also overcome most environmental challenges by entering partnerships with qualified local partners who possess the right knowledge, requisite capital and technical know how.

It is critical for the public and private sectors to work together in “SHARED PURPOSE”, which is a key tenet of Africapitalism -  the economic philosophy I espouse, which calls for the private sector to play a key role in Africa’s social and economic development by investing in strategic sectors for both economic profit and social prosperity.

In conclusion, I stressed the critical role of power in creating opportunities for Africa’s jobless youth. In the 21st century, the level of poverty we have in Africa and the dire youth unemployment, to a large extent, can be solved by improving access to power, and by extension other infrastructure deficiencies and deficits. The African Energy Leaders Group (AELG), a community of African energy leaders including Presidents and leading corporates which I co-chair, and other positively like-minded coalitions are making progress, but there is still a lot to be done. We need faster progress.

CrimeOperatives Of Rapid Response Squad Nab Inter-state 'Okada" Thief In Lagos(pic) by chie8(op): 12:22pm On Sep 14, 2016
Operatives of the Rapid Response Squad (RRS) of Lagos State Police Command, over the weekend, arrested one Jamiu Bello, 26, who specializes in motorcycle theft, popularly known as ‘okada’ in virtually all the states in the South West. The suspect was arrested by the RRS operatives while trying to steal a motorcycle with the registration number, KTU 388 QG, belonging to Israel Ikyav, a commercial rider at Ijora Olopa, Lagos.


According to the victim, "I parked my okada beside a canteen around Ijora. As I entered the canteen to eat, I noticed people outside were chasing one guy…. One of my colleagues rushed inside the canteen to call me that my okada had been stolen by one guy. I left the full plate of food I ordered for and joined them in chasing him…. if not for RRS operatives' riders, the suspect would have made away with my bike. We knew that we could not catch up with him because he was far ahead of us with the bike already…. I quickly alerted the RRS riders, who were patrolling the area about the incident. And, immediately, they chased the suspect with their bikes…. After so much effort, they double - crossed him with their bikes…. at this point, the thief abandoned the bike and he tried to escape on foot and then with another motor cyclist before he was arrested."


The suspect, a father of three children, gave account on how he has been stealing bikes in states across the South-West: "I started this crime about two years ago. There were two of us and we operated in Lagos, Ogun, Oyo, Ekiti and Ondo States…. my accomplice whose name is Ibijuwon is currently serving a jail term in Kirikiri Prison…. The day we went for an operation where he was arrested, it was around Lagos Island, I managed to escape with a stolen bike while he was arrested and subsequently taken to the court where he was eventually sentenced to jail."


He further explained, "on this fateful day, I left Epe to Yaba area. On getting to Yaba, I looked around to know how to start the day's job there but I couldn’t find any motorcycle to steal around the area…. Then, I decided to move to Ijora-Olopa with the hope of stealing any bike on sight. I contracted a commercial motorcycle from Yaba to Ijora…. at Ijora, I saw this man (his victim) when he parked his bike outside and entered the canteen. I noticed that he had locked its steering. So, I quickly asked the rider who took me from Yaba that I wanted to alight to see my brother briefly in that area, unknown to him that I had a sinister motive".


The suspect added "I moved closer to the bike and broke its locked steering. Then I mounted it and zoomed off…. Meanwhile, I had abandoned the commercial rider who brought me to the area. When I was on the bike, I thought I had escaped. Suddenly, I saw two RRS motorcycles pursuing me. I sped off but I was so unlucky they caught up with me despite the fact that I over sped…. I attempted to escape by joining another motorcyclist, yet I was caught again, that was how I gave up."


While confessing to the crime at the RRS's Headquarters, the suspect revealed that his two receivers of stolen motorcycles are based in Lagos. He explained, "I have stolen no fewer than 20 motorcycles across South West. If I go to other states apart from Lagos to operate, I will ride the bike down to Lagos to sell here…. I have two receivers of these stolen bikes. One of them lives at Alamutu in Mushin while the other is in Ijora…. I sold one motorcycle for N40,000 depending on how clean they looked."


The suspect whose body was filled with scars noted that they were as a result of the injuries from his past criminal activities. "All these scars on my body were healed injuries inflicted on me by mob actions anytime I was caught stealing motorcycles. I am just an unrepentant thief because I was supposed to have changed my way of life," he said.


The State's Police Public Relations Officer, Superintendent of Police, SP Dolapo Badmus, who confirmed the incidence, said that efforts are ongoing to arrest the receivers of the stolen motorcycles. She said that the suspect will be charged to court upon completion of the investigation.
